Why i get headeche in my temples after bath or after lestening to music with headphones?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Clinching: Apparently you get what it is described as tension type a headache . A situation results from muscle spasm . May be you clinch while listening to the music , that would put a lot of pressure on the temporalis muscles at the temple area. Try to observe that.Also check to see if you grind your teeth while asleep(bruxisim).
